Buhari Approves Allocation of Houses to 1994 AFCON Super Eagles Squad After Years of Delay

President Muhammadu Buhari has approved the allocation of houses for the twenty two members of the Super Eagles at the National Housing Estates in the states of their choice.

Recall, that the then military government of Sani Abacha had promised the Tunisia 1994 winning Super Eagles Squad houses for their performance which was for years unredeemed.

After several years, the Federal Government has redeemed its promise.

This was disclosed, by the President represented by the Minister of Humanitarian Affairs, Disaster Management and Social Development, Sadiya Farouq who was in Zamfara to commission National Housing Estates.
